Jack’s Lifeline: The Search for the Trident of Poseidon

Jack’s quest for survival is a thrilling journey, as he races against time to discover the Trident of Poseidon. This legendary artifact is his only hope. However, this is not your typical treasure hunt. It’s a race against time, with Jack’s life hanging in the balance.

Forging Unlikely Alliances

On this quest, Jack finds himself in need of allies. He must forge an uneasy alliance with Carina Smyth, a brilliant and beautiful astronomer, and Henry, a headstrong young sailor in the Royal Navy. This alliance is a testament to the fact that when it comes to survival, even pirates can’t go it alone.

Carina Smyth: The Brains Behind the Operation

Carina Smyth, played by Kaya Scodelario, is a key character in this saga. With her brilliance and beauty, she brings a unique dimension to this thrilling quest. Her astronomical knowledge plays a pivotal role in the search for the Trident of Poseidon.

Henry: The Determined Sailor

Henry, portrayed by Brenton Thwaites, is a headstrong young sailor in the Royal Navy. His determination and courage are crucial to the team’s survival. His character is a powerful reminder of the fact that in the face of adversity, courage is an invaluable asset.
